Advertisement

基于双随机相位编码的MATLAB光学图像加密与解密算法

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本研究提出了一种基于双随机相位编码的MATLAB实现方案,用于光学图像的安全加密与解密,提供高效的数据保护方法。 基于双随机相位编码的光学图像加密解密算法包含代码及说明文档《基于双随机相位编码的光学图像加密解密算法.pdf》以及软件演示视频《软件演示.mp4》。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• MATLAB
    优质
    本研究提出了一种基于双随机相位编码的MATLAB实现方案,用于光学图像的安全加密与解密,提供高效的数据保护方法。 基于双随机相位编码的光学图像加密解密算法包含代码及说明文档《基于双随机相位编码的光学图像加密解密算法.pdf》以及软件演示视频《软件演示.mp4》。
  • Matlab(附源 4118期).zip
    优质
    本资源提供了一种利用Matlab实现的双随机相位掩模技术进行图像加密和解密的方法,包含完整的源代码。适用于需要深入研究或实际应用图像安全传输的技术人员和学生。 在图像处理领域,数据安全与隐私保护至关重要,特别是在网络传输和存储过程中。本段落将探讨一种基于MATLAB实现的双随机相位图像加密技术,该技术为图像提供了强大的安全保障。 在这个项目中,您会发现一个视频教程及相关MATLAB源代码,帮助理解并实践这一方法。双随机相位图像加密是一种先进的加密策略,利用了光学系统的随机相位编码原理。在该技术中,原始图像首先被转换成复数形式,并通过两个独立的随机相位掩模进行操作。 这两个随机相位掩模是保密的关键因素,为每个像素提供了不同的相位信息,从而极大地增加了破解难度。加密过程包括生成两个独立且随机的相位掩模(分别称为相位掩模1和2),原始图像与这些相位掩模通过卷积或傅立叶变换操作产生两组加密后的相位信息。 接着,这两组相位信息通常会通过异或操作结合在一起形成最终的加密图像。这样做的目的是确保即使攻击者获取了部分数据也无法还原出原始图像。在解密阶段,则必须使用相同的随机相位掩模对加密图像进行逆操作,包括傅立叶逆变换、相位恢复和异或操作等步骤。 MATLAB作为一种强大的数值计算与可视化工具,在实现这种复杂算法方面表现出色。源代码可能包含了生成随机相位掩模的函数以及处理图像数据的功能(如`fft2`和`ifft2`命令)。通过运行这些代码,您可以直观地看到加密和解密过程,并理解每个步骤如何影响图像的质量与安全性。 此项目不仅对于学习图像加密技术具有很高价值,还适合希望提升MATLAB编程能力的开发者。通过对理论知识转化为可执行代码的研究实践,可以深入理解和提高在图像处理及信息安全方面的技能水平。此外,这个项目也强调了将理论知识应用于实际场景的重要性,这对于科研工作者或工程技术人员来说是宝贵的。 通过研究和使用提供的资源(包括视频教程与MATLAB源码),您可以掌握这种高效且安全的加密技术,并可能将其应用到更广泛的领域如云存储、物联网设备或者敏感数据传输中。无论您是学生、教师还是专业开发人员,都能从中受益并提升自己在图像处理及密码学领域的知识和技能水平。
  • DRPMMATLAB仿真及仿真录
    优质
    本研究采用DRPM双随机相位编码技术进行图像加密和解密,并通过MATLAB实现相关算法仿真及其视频录制。 版本:MATLAB 2021a 内容概述: 录制了一段基于DRPM双随机相位编码的图像加解密算法在MATLAB中的仿真操作录像,通过跟随该视频的操作步骤可以实现相应的仿真结果。 研究领域: 本项目属于图像处理与信息安全交叉领域的技术应用,具体涉及图像加密和解密方法的研究。 适用人群: 适合本科、硕士等层次的学生及科研人员用于学习参考或实验验证。
  • 】利用进行(附带Matlab).zip
    优质
    本资源提供基于双随机相位编码技术实现的图像加密与解密方法,包含详尽的算法说明及实用的Matlab源代码,适用于研究和教学。 基于双随机相位编码实现的图像加密解密方法包含Matlab源码。
  • 全息虚拟
    优质
    本研究提出了一种结合计算全息技术与双随机相位编码的虚拟光学加密方法,旨在提高数据的安全性和抗攻击能力。通过在数字域模拟光学变换过程,该方法能够有效保护信息完整性并实现高效密钥管理。 本段落基于计算全息与双随机相位编码技术提出了一种虚拟光学加密算法。该方法使用了两套空间参数不同但随机相位函数相同的双随机相位编码系统来实现加解密过程。 在加密过程中,首先利用一套双随机相位编码系统对明文数据进行初次加密,并将生成的初始密文作为物光信息;随后与另一套系统的参考光信息叠加并经过滤波处理后得出最终的密文数据。而在解密阶段,则需先恢复出最初的参考光信息,再计算得到物光信息,在通过双随机相位编码系统即可还原明文。 理论分析证明了该算法的有效性,并且实验结果表明此方法具有强大的抗唯密文攻击和选择明文攻击的能力。
  • 】利用MATLAB实现菲涅尔域【附带Matlab 4548期】
    优质
    本项目采用MATLAB编程实现在菲涅尔域内通过双随机相位编码技术进行图像的安全加密与解密过程,提供完整代码供学习参考。 在上分享的Matlab相关资料均包含可运行代码并经过测试确认有效,适合初学者使用。 1. 代码压缩包内容: - 主函数:main.m; - 调用函数:其他m文件;无需单独运行。 - 运行结果效果图也一并提供。 2. 所需Matlab版本为2019b。如遇问题,请根据提示进行修改,或者联系博主寻求帮助。 3. 代码的运行步骤如下: 步骤一:将所有文件放置在当前工作目录中; 步骤二:双击打开main.m文件; 步骤三:点击运行按钮直至程序执行完毕并得到结果; 4. 对于仿真咨询及其他服务需求,可以联系博主。 - 提供博客或资源的完整代码 - 期刊或参考文献复现 - Matlab程序定制开发 - 科研合作机会 图像加密功能包括:DNA混沌图像加密、Arnold置乱图像加密解密、Logistic+Tent+Kent+Hent算法组合使用的图像加密与解密方法,以及双随机相位编码光学图像的加解密技术。 此外还有正交拉丁方置乱和RSA算法应用在图片上的加解密方案。小波变换DWT及其结合混沌系统的图像加密手段也涵盖其中。
  • 混沌理论改进方案
    优质
    本研究提出了一种利用混沌理论优化双随机相位编码技术的新型图像加密方法,显著提升了数据安全性和抗攻击能力。 本段落介绍了一种改进的菲涅耳域双随机相位编码图像加密系统。该系统通过将原图转换为相位信息的方式解决了原始算法对第一块相位模板及第一次衍射距离不敏感的问题,并在后续加入了复值图像振幅和相位替代再次加密的过程,使得最终生成的密文像素分布更加均匀。 此外,在改进中引入了三种不同的混沌系统来产生所需的随机模板。利用这些系统的非线性和初值敏感特性,该加密方法能够在减少所需密钥数量的同时扩大密钥空间,并增加整个系统的复杂性。 通过仿真实验对该算法的有效性、统计特性和对密钥的敏感度进行了分析测试,结果显示改进后的方案显著提高了原始图像加密的安全性能。
  • 二维混沌序列系统菲涅尔变换(附带Matlab 4323期).zip
    优质
    本资源提供了一种结合二维混沌序列和双随机相位技术的菲涅尔变换图像加密方法,包含详细的Matlab实现代码。适合研究与学习使用。 在Matlab领域上传的视频均配有对应的完整代码,并且这些代码均可运行,经过测试确认有效,适合初学者使用。 1、代码压缩包内容包括: - 主函数:main.m; - 其他调用函数(m文件);无需单独运行。 - 运行结果效果图展示。 2、所使用的Matlab版本为2019b。如果在运行过程中遇到问题,请根据提示进行相应的修改,或者寻求博主的帮助解决疑问。 3、操作步骤如下: 第一步:将所有相关文件放置于Matlab的当前工作目录中; 第二步:双击打开main.m文件; 第三步:点击运行按钮直至程序执行完毕并展示最终结果。 4、对于其他仿真咨询需求(例如代码提供,文献复现,定制编程服务或科研合作)可以联系博主进行进一步探讨。
  • 单通道彩色.zip
    优质
    本研究提出了一种新颖的单通道彩色图像加密技术,采用双相位编码方案,有效提升图像数据的安全传输与存储能力。 我编写了一段使用相位掩膜结合傅立叶变换进行图像加密的代码,并采用了双随机相位加密方法。我的代码每行都有注释以便于理解,并附有参考资料以及用例图片,以供参考和测试。
  • 项目-Matlab、操作演示视频及GUI界面和实验说明文档(适用毕业设计).zip
    优质
    本资源提供基于双随机相位编码的光学图像加密与解密项目的全套材料,包括Matlab源代码、操作演示视频、GUI界面以及详细的实验说明文档。非常适合用于毕业设计项目学习与研究。 基于4f系统的双随机相位编码(DPRE, Double Random Phase Coding)是经典的光学图像加密方法之一,通过引入Arnold变换和混沌系统增强了DPRE的非线性特性。具体而言,在这一项目中首先利用Arnold迭代变换对原始待加密图像进行置乱处理;随后基于Logistic映射与Chen映射构造两块随机相位模板作为物平面及频谱面上使用的随机相位板,将经过上述步骤调制的图像通过这两层相位板后获得最终的加密图像。此外,该项目还进行了数值仿真分析以验证该算法在各类攻击(如统计攻击、剪切攻击和噪声干扰)下的有效性和实用性。 项目最后开发了一款基于MATLAB GUI界面的应用程序,用于实现经过Arnold变换与混沌理论改进后的双随机相位编码图像加密解密功能。实验结果表明:此方案不仅具备较低的时间复杂度,并且能够有效地防御各种类型的恶意攻击;同时由于其庞大的密钥空间和良好的密钥敏感性,在安全性方面表现出色,具有较高的实用价值。